Patents Assigned to Amazon Technologies, Inc.
  • Patent number: 12332681
    Abstract: A clock selection circuit allows seamless switching between different clock signals in a clock distribution network. The clock selection circuit can be an Integrated Circuit (IC). The clock signals can be analyzed by a processor in communication with the IC to ensure the clock signals are validated. Analysis can include comparing time stamps between received pulses of the clock signals to determine if the clock signals are occurring at regular intervals. The processor can then assign a priority order to the clock signals and select one of the clock signals to use. An identifier associated with the selected clock signal can be programmed into the IC. The IC can then redistribute the selected clock signal to multiple other ICs in a hierarchical clock distribution network. Ultimately, the distributed clock signal can be received by server computers to ensure instances being executed have accurate and synchronized timing.
    Type: Grant
    Filed: June 13, 2022
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Scott Andrew Emery, James Paul Rivers
  • Patent number: 12333041
    Abstract: A federated permission management service provides clients with customized access to a data set using customized authorization metadata. The federated permission management service may define and apply permissions that are defined at a data lake that provides access to many different data sets from many different sources, as well as those permissions that may be defined at the source of the data set, which may be provided when performing a data sharing request. By allowing for permissions to be specified at the data lake in addition to permissions specified at a source of a data set, the permission management service can provide a fine-grained access control to specific objects of the data set, such as specific columns, specific rows, or specific cells of a database to be shared, even for those data sets in the data lake having different sources.
    Type: Grant
    Filed: November 25, 2022
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Mohammad Foyzur Rahman, Vladimir Ponomarenko, William Michael McCreedy, Ramy Nazier, Pavel Sokolov, Venkata Naga Raja Sri Harsha Kesapragada, Karsten Jancke, Kostiantyn Dymov, Dmytro Lebedyev, Vinay Singh, Krishnaditya Kandregula, Sharda Kishin Khubchandani, Sachet Saurabh, Purvaja Narayanaswamy
  • Patent number: 12330783
    Abstract: Described are systems and methods for active weathervaning of a hybrid flight aerial vehicle, such as an unmanned aerial vehicle (UAV). Active weathervaning of the hybrid flight aerial vehicle during can be provided during vertical takeoff and landing (VTOL)/hover flight without the assistance of any low-speed wind sensors and during transitions between VTOL/hover flight and fixed-wing, wing-borne, horizontal flight. Additionally, active weathervaning can be provided during propulsion mechanism failure conditions where the aerial vehicle may be experiencing failure conditions associated with one or more propulsion mechanisms.
    Type: Grant
    Filed: December 10, 2021
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Michael Szmuk, Daniel Robert Hentzen, Marco Antonio De Barros Ceze, Raghu Venkataraman, Umut Zalluhoglu, Christopher J. McFarland, Simone M. Airoldi, Kyle W. Reeve, Raymond H. Kraft
  • Patent number: 12335087
    Abstract: Technology is described for receiving an event notification produced by a source service. A negative cache may be searched for a cache entry for the event notification. The negative cache may be determined to not include the cache entry for the event notification. The event notification may be determined to satisfy a filter rule included in a filter rules table, which may indicate that the event notification is useful information for a destination service. The event notification may be transmitted to the destination service.
    Type: Grant
    Filed: July 20, 2022
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ventor: Rishi Baldawa
  • Patent number: 12334081
    Abstract: A voice controlled assistant has a housing to hold one or more microphones, one or more speakers, and various computing components. The housing has an elongated cylindrical body extending along a center axis between a base end and a top end. The microphone(s) are mounted in the top end and the speaker(s) are mounted proximal to the base end. The microphone(s) and speaker(s) are coaxially aligned along the center axis. The speaker(s) are oriented to output sound directionally toward the base end and opposite to the microphone(s) in the top end. The sound may then be redirected in a radial outward direction from the center axis at the base end so that the sound is output symmetric to, and equidistance from, the microphone(s).
    Type: Grant
    Filed: May 16, 2024
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ventor: Timothy Theodore List
  • Patent number: 12333481
    Abstract: Systems and methods are described herein for routing data by transferring a physical storage device for at least part of a route between source and destination locations. In one example, a computing resource service provider, may receive a request to transfer data from a customer center to a data center. The service provider may determine a route, which includes one or more of a physical path or a network path, for the data loaded onto a physical storage device to reach the data center from the customer center. Determining the route may include associating respective cost values to individual physical and network paths between physical stations between the customer and end data centers, and selecting one or more of the paths to reduce a total cost of the route. Route information may then be associated with the physical storage device based on the route.
    Type: Grant
    Filed: September 25, 2023
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Ryan Michael Eccles, Siddhartha Roy, Vaibhav Tyagi, Wayne William Duso, Danny Wei
  • Patent number: 12334063
    Abstract: Systems and methods develop and apply one or more extractive summarization models for locating contact center conversation details in a transcript, extracting pertinent verbiage, and, in a transformation of the communication details, automatically generating summaries at one or more levels of abstraction, the summaries in full sentences, in a manner that a contact center agent understands. The models are trained using machine learning algorithms.
    Type: Grant
    Filed: November 26, 2021
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Wei Xiao, Dejiao Zhang, Kaustubh Kishor Khanke, Henghui Zhu, Ramesh M Nallapati, Andrew Oliver Arnold, Bing Xiang, Xiaofei Ma, Anuroop Arora, Atul Deo
  • Patent number: 12335830
    Abstract: Technologies directed to detecting and controlling different types of ZigBee devices on different ZigBee networks reliably and efficiently. In one method of operating a first device, the method includes detecting first and second Zigbee networks. The method sends a first request to rejoin the first Zigbee network, the first request being encoded with the first network key. While rejoined as part of the first Zigbee network, the method detects a first set of devices part of the first Zigbee network. The method repeats this for a second set of devices part of the second Zigbee network. The method determines, using the device data, a subset of controllable devices located in proximity, and sends a message with the command to each in response to receiving a command. Each message is encoded with a respective network key and a respective link key specified in the device data.
    Type: Grant
    Filed: August 22, 2022
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Tao Jiang, Hans Edward Birch-Jensen
  • Patent number: 12333264
    Abstract: Systems and methods are provided for use of use of fuzzy-match-based translation suggestions to augment machine translation of input sentences or other texts. A machine translation system may use a model trained to translate a source language input to a target language output based on pseudo-randomly selected translation suggestions in the target language, while at inference time the machine translation system may use translation selections associated with source language samples that have a high degree of similarity to the source language input to be translated. To efficiently use the translation suggestions, they may be encoded in context with the source language input to be translated, and the machine translation system may use the encoded translation suggestions with to generate a translation in the target language.
    Type: Grant
    Filed: March 21, 2022
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Cuong Hoang, Prashant Mathur, Marcello Federico, Devendra Singh Sachan
  • Patent number: 12333491
    Abstract: Described is a system for counting stacked items using image analysis. In one implementation, an image of an inventory location with stacked items is obtained and processed to determine the number of items stacked at the inventory location. In some instances, the item closest to the camera that obtains the image may be the only item viewable in the image. Using image analysis, such as depth mapping or Histogram of Oriented Gradients (HOG) algorithms, the distance of the item from the camera and the shelf of the inventory location can be determined. Using this information, and known dimension information for the item, a count of the number of items stacked at an inventory location may be determined.
    Type: Grant
    Filed: April 18, 2023
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Xiaofeng Ren, Avishkar Misra, Ohil Krishnamurthy Manyam, Liefeng Bo, Sudarshan Narasimha Raghavan, Christopher Robert Towers, Gopi Prashanth Gopal, Yasser Baseer Asmi
  • Publication number: 20250190840
    Abstract: Techniques for tracking and maintaining queues used for executing pending quantum objects using respective quantum processing units (QPUs) are disclosed. An amount of time to execute a given quantum object depends on many factors, and a non-deterministic nature of quantum computing resources is such that, while knowing an expected wait time in a queue for access to a given QPU is useful, it is difficult to reliably determine. A quantum computing service that manages submission and execution of quantum objects to respective QPUs may apply QPU-specific machine learning models in order to predict expected wait times and provide that information to customers. By generating labeled datasets using ground truth wait times pertaining to already-executed quantum objects, respective machine learning models may be trained using a supervised learning technique, which may be a self-contained and re-occurring process.
    Type: Application
    Filed: December 7, 2023
    Publication date: June 12, 2025
    Applicant: Amazon Technologies, Inc.
    Inventors: Christian Bruun Madsen, Zia Mohammad, Viraj Vilas Chaudhari, Ramanathan Ramanathan
  • Publication number: 20250193193
    Abstract: An attestation service is configured to receive a request to enable attestation for a compute instance according to an attestation policy indicating one or more baseline health measurement values for validating compute instances. The attestation service provides a network endpoint for the compute instance to request attestation. The attestation service receives, via the network endpoint from a compute instance, one or more health measurement values of the compute instance. The attestation service validates the compute instance based at least on a comparison of the one or more current health measurement values and the one or more baseline health measurement values. The attestation service, in response to validating the compute instance, generates an attestation token indicating that the compute instance is authorized to access a secured resource of the provider network.
    Type: Application
    Filed: December 17, 2024
    Publication date: June 12, 2025
    Applicant: Amazon Technologies, Inc.
    Inventor: Samartha Chandrashekar
  • Publication number: 20250190312
    Abstract: Changes made to a database table are accumulated, in durable storage, and snapshots of partitions of the table are obtained. For successive snapshots of a partition, the system accesses a previous snapshot, applies changes from the accumulated changes, and stores the updated snapshot to a durable data store. The accumulated changes and the successive partition snapshots are made available to restore the database to any point in time across a continuum between successive snapshots. Although each partition of the table may have a backup snapshot that was generated at a time different from when other partition snapshots were generated, changes from respective change logs may be selectively log-applied to distinct partitions of a table to generate an on-demand backup of the entire table at common point-in-time across partitions. Point-in-time restores of a table may rely upon a similar process to coalesce partition snapshots that are not aligned in time.
    Type: Application
    Filed: December 16, 2024
    Publication date: June 12, 2025
    Applicant: Amazon Technologies, Inc.
    Inventors: Akshat Vig, Tate Andrew Certain, Go Hori
  • Patent number: 12327141
    Abstract: Approaches presented herein can allocate resources in such a way that sufficient capacity will be provided to perform a job or task, while minimizing any excess capacity included with those allocated resources. A number of jobs can be performed with differently sized resource instances in some embodiments, to determine an instance size, from a set of available sizes, that is appropriate for each of those jobs. Various parameters for those jobs can be determined, and those values associated with the determined instance sizes. When a new job is received that is to be performed, the parameter values for that job can be compared against the corresponding values for these testing jobs, and an instance size can be selected where a testing job that was successfully performed with that instance size had the same or larger values for these parameters.
    Type: Grant
    Filed: November 22, 2021
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Akhil Raj Azhikodan, Gunjan Garg, Narayan Agrawal
  • Patent number: 12327564
    Abstract: Techniques for performing voice-based user recognition are described. When a device receives audio data corresponding to a spoken user input, the device may generate spoken user input embedding data representing speech characteristics of the spoken user input. The device may also identify user embedding data representing speech characteristics of a user known to the device. A machine learning (ML) model may process the spoken user input embedding data to generate reduced spoken user input embedding data including a reduced number of dimensions, where the reduced number of dimensions are functions of the higher number of dimensions of the spoken user input embedding data.
    Type: Grant
    Filed: September 29, 2021
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Zhenning Tan, Eunjung Han, Ruirui Li, Hongda Mao, Yuguang Yang, Oguz Hasan Elibol, Itay Teller, Mohamed G Mahmoud, Andreas Stolcke
  • Patent number: 12326963
    Abstract: Systems and methods for automated actions for application policy violations are disclosed. For example, policy violation evaluation components may monitor requests and/or responses from one or more applications to identify content policy violations. When a violation is identified, an automated decision engine utilizes data representing the policy violation along with, in example, contextual information about the policy violation to identify a rule from a rules database that is associated with the policy violation. An action is determined from the selected rule, and a command is generated to perform the action in response to the policy violation.
    Type: Grant
    Filed: October 20, 2023
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ventor: Madhura Ashwin Raj
  • Patent number: 12327551
    Abstract: A system configured to detect custom acoustic events, where the system generates an acoustic event profile for the custom acoustic event based on a natural language description and without a sample of the sound. The system may generate a profile for a new custom sound based on a natural language description provided by the user; for example, a “microwave beep.” If the system does not have an existing event profile for a microwave beep, the system may ask the user questions to determine whether any existing event profiles are close (e.g., is the sound similar to a “fan,” “alarm,” “appliance beep,” etc.). The system may detect an event that may be a possible match for the custom sound and ask the user to verify whether the detected event corresponds to the custom sound. The system may update the event profile based on the user's response.
    Type: Grant
    Filed: December 15, 2022
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Xiuye Chen, Qingming Tang, Chieh-Chi Kao, Viktor Rozgic, Chao Wang
  • Patent number: 12328309
    Abstract: The present disclosure generally relates to systems and methods for configuring Security Assertion Markup Language (SAML) access network-based services. An identity provider can authenticate the customer and provide SAML authentication information to a SAML configuration service. Based on the customer's authentication information, the SAML configuration service can discover SAML-enabled services and analyze the customer's usage pattern of each discovered service. The SAML configuration service may prioritize the discovered services based on the analysis and transmit a list of the discovered services to the customer based on a sequence of the prioritization. The SAML configuration service also can configure SAML configuration associated with each SAML-enabled service by identifying one or more parameters and applying parsing rules.
    Type: Grant
    Filed: June 24, 2022
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Raghavarao Sodabathina, Imtiaz Sayed
  • Patent number: 12327550
    Abstract: Systems and methods for intelligent device grouping are disclosed. An environment, such as a home, may have a number of voice-enabled devices and accessory devices that may be controlled by the voice-enabled devices. One or more models, such as linguistics model(s) and/or device affinity models may be utilized to determine which accessory devices are candidates for inclusion in a device group, and a recommendation for grouping the devices may be provided. Device-group naming recommendations may also be generated and may be sent to users.
    Type: Grant
    Filed: June 23, 2022
    Date of Patent: June 10,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Zeya Chen, Charles Edwin Ashton Brett, Jay Patel, Lizhen Peng, Aniruddha Basak, Hongyang Wang, Yunfeng Jiang, Sven Eberhardt, Akshay Kumar, William Evan Welbourne, Sara Hillenmeyer
  • Patent number: D1079782
    Type: Grant
    Filed: September 11, 2023
    Date of Patent: June 17, 2025
    Assignee: Amazon Technologies, Inc.
    Inventors: Victoria Hunt, Justin Brousseau, Jonathan E. Cohn, Paul Douglas Grearson, Michael James O'Connor, Marcus Townsend, Jon Varteresian